Marion man charged with child pornography | Crime
WILLIAMSON COUNTY, IL (KFVS) - A Marion man was charged with possession of child pornography and appeared in court for the first time on July 13.
Brandon Scott Coffey, 24, faces up to 10 years in prison, $250,000 in fines and from five years to a lifetime of probation after incarceration if convicted.
His trial is currently set for September 10, 2012 in federal court in Benton, Ill.
The investigation into Coffey's case was conducted by the Secret Service Southern Illinois Cyber Crimes Task Force, and many state and local law enforcement agencies.
The case was brought forward as part of Project Safe Childhood, a nationwide program to battle the growing epidemic of child exploitation and abuse. The project gathers federal, state, and local resources to find, apprehend, and prosecute child pornographers, and find and rescue their victims.
